Free-to-Play Games on PlayStation: Your Gateway to Cost-Free Fun

The PlayStation Store offers a plethora of free-to-play games that don’t require a PS Plus subscription. These games vary widely in genre, from fast-paced shooters to immersive RPGs and strategy titles.

  • Fortnite: A cultural phenomenon, this battle royale is available for free and includes various game modes and regular updates.

  • Apex Legends: This team-based hero shooter is known for its smooth gameplay and tactical depth.

  • Call of Duty: Warzone: If you like large-scale battles and tactical gameplay, Warzone offers intense combat for free.

  • Genshin Impact: A vast open-world RPG with a compelling story and engaging combat.

  • Rocket League: A unique blend of soccer and driving, Rocket League is both competitive and fun.

These free-to-play games typically offer in-game purchases for cosmetic items and other enhancements but are fully playable without spending any real money. It’s a perfect way to dive into competitive multiplayer without needing a PS Plus subscription.

Single-Player Games: An Offline Haven

For those who prefer offline gaming experiences, the PlayStation offers a vast library of single-player games that are playable without PS Plus. These games often feature deep storylines, complex characters, and immersive worlds to explore.

Many players enjoy the freedom of playing games that focus on solo adventures. These games include genres like RPGs, action-adventures, platformers, and puzzle games. As long as these games are primarily designed for single-player mode, they can be enjoyed without any subscription needed. Consider popular choices like “The Witcher 3,” “God of War,” and “Horizon Zero Dawn” that provide extensive single-player campaigns. If you are unsure if a game requires a subscription it is best to check its listing in the Playstation Store for explicit details.

What About Games Requiring Online Single Player?

Some games might have single-player modes that require internet access. These games usually include features that require an online connection, such as content updates or account verification. However, these aren’t the same as requiring PS Plus. You’ll need an internet connection, but no PS Plus is necessary to play the single-player aspect. A common misconception is that if a game is online then it requires a ps plus subscription, this is not the case with single player games.

Playstation Games and Local Multiplayer

Local multiplayer games are another great option for those who want to game without a PS Plus subscription. You can enjoy these games with friends or family on the same console. Many titles offer competitive or cooperative gameplay modes that don’t require an online connection or an active PS Plus membership, allowing for in-person play sessions.

Titles in this category include fighting games, sports games, party games and many more. Games such as “Mortal Kombat,” “FIFA,” and “Overcooked” are all playable in local multiplayer mode without needing a PS Plus subscription. These games are perfect for social gatherings and family game nights. Many players find these options appealing for easy offline play sessions.

Common Misconceptions about PS Plus

Many gamers confuse online multiplayer with the need for PS Plus. It’s important to distinguish that only online multiplayer features of games typically require a PS Plus subscription. Single-player and local multiplayer modes do not. A common example of this is game share, for instance can you game share with 2 people is a topic that gets mixed up with online play. Understanding the difference will help players maximize their gaming budget while still getting the most out of their consoles.

Another misconception is that you need PS Plus to access the PlayStation Store or to download free-to-play games. This is false, as you can browse the store and download any free titles without a subscription. It is also not required to update games that you own. PS Plus enhances the online multiplayer experience, but is not essential to enjoy a vast selection of gaming experiences.

Can You Play PlayStation Games Through Remote Play Without PS Plus?

Many PlayStation owners wonder if the PS Plus subscription is needed to use remote play. The answer is no, you can still enjoy remote play, where you stream games to another device. While PS Plus is not a prerequisite for remote play, you will still need an internet connection, but this is not connected to the PS Plus subscription. This allows you to play your owned games on compatible devices without being on the same network as your console.

Can You Access Demos Without PS Plus?

Yes, you can access game demos on the PlayStation Store without a PS Plus subscription. These demos are often available for free to give you an idea of what a game is like before deciding to purchase it.
